"Highest Number" Ever: Ireland Doctors Successfully Remove 55 Batteries From Woman's Gut And Stomach

Doctors in Ireland recently removed more than 50 AA and AAA batteries from a 66-year-old woman's gut and stomach after she swallowed them in an apparent act of deliberate self-harm.
